Does the judicial record in Brazil include information on convictions for crimes of embezzlement or corruption in the business sphere?
Brazil Yes, judicial records in Brazil include information on convictions for crimes of embezzlement or corruption in the business sphere. These crimes are considered serious and, if a person has been convicted of embezzlement, bribery or other acts of corruption in the business sphere, that information will be recorded in their judicial record.

What is the procedure to adopt in Brazil?
The procedure to adopt in Brazil involves requesting authorization to adopt before the judiciary, carrying out psychosocial and legal evaluations, registering in the adopter registry, searching for a boy or girl suitable for adoption, and finally, carrying out of the legal procedures to formalize the adoption.

What is the situation of the rights of people with disabilities in the field of public transportation in Honduras?
People with disabilities have protected rights in the field of public transportation in Honduras. There are laws and regulations that seek to guarantee their access to public transportation services, the adaptation of infrastructure and vehicles for their use, and the training of personnel to meet their specific needs. However, there are still challenges in terms of full accessibility and the elimination of barriers that limit their mobility and participation in public transport.
Does the KYC process apply in the same way to natural and legal persons in Costa Rica?
The KYC process is applied differently to natural and legal persons in Costa Rica. In the case of natural persons, the collection of personal information is required, while for legal entities, information about the entity and its beneficial owners must be collected, which can be more complex. The KYC of legal entities seeks to identify those who have actual control over the entity.
